Can the FBI lock or monitor your computer?

For breaking a law?

    No. The FBI would get a warrant and seize your computer. Simply locking it doesn't prevent you from hiding or destroying evidence.

    If you have a warning from the FBI, it is a virus. If they are asking for money, it is a scam.

    If you search "FBI virus", you will get instructions for removal.
